Saw this on the Motor World Online forums. strange...
Electronic Arts (Nasdaq:ERTS) is preparing to launch its advanced casual game "NBA STREET Online" through the game's China region operator, T2CN, in the first half of 2009, reports 17173.com quoting EA China Vice General Manager Zhong Xingxing. Electronic Arts plans to release MMORPG "Warhammer Online," massively multiplayer online real-time strategy game "BattleForge" and car racing game "Need For Speed: Motor City Online" in China in the future, said Zhong.

T2CN owner GigaMedia Limited (Nasdaq:GIGM) signed a three-year licensing agreement for NBA STREET Online in July.
